Gaeng Jued Woon Sen

Thai clear noodle soup

Preparation

  1. Soak the noodles in cold water for 10 mins to soften, then drain
  2. Soak the mushrooms in hot water to soften
  3. Discard the stems of the mushrooms and slice the tops
  4. Mix the meat, soy sauce and ground white pepper together well, and form into approx 12 small meatballs
  5. Heat the oil in a medium pan to a high heat
  6. Add garlic and fry for 30 seconds.
  7. Add chicken broth and bring to a boil over high heat.
  8. Add balls of minced pork or chicken
  9. Add carrots. Cook 1 minute.
  10. Add the noodles and stir thoroughly.
  11. Add the fish sauce, sugar, mushrooms, and white pepper.
  12. Remove from heat.
  13. Garnish with spring onion and coriander.

Notes

    Ingredients

    • 2 tsp vegetable oil
    • 4 cloves garlic, crushed with the side of a knife
    • 1L Chicken Stock
    • 60g Glass Noodles
    • 140g minced chicken breast
    • 1 tsp fish Sauce
    • 1 tsp light Soy Sauce
    • ¼tsp sugar
    • 6 mushrooms, ideally chinese
    • 2 small carrots, sliced lengthwise very thin
    • ½tsp ground White Pepper
    • 2 Spring Onions, green part only, cut lengthwise
    • 2 tbsp fresh coriander
